As you can imagine I've been to many taco shops and Mexican restaurants but never to one with such a unique name. Taco Cow immediately proved to be different, it's not your typical taco shop, it's not an outta the way taco truck or a place that specializes in street tacos. In my opinion the best way to describe Taco Cow is... gourmet tacos for people that would rather not pay $7.00 per taco. The selection of tacos is extensive at Taco Cow and just to give you an idea how much variety they have let me share our order.

Carne Asada Taco

California Taco

Taco Shrimp

Cauliflower Taco

Fiesta Chicken Taco

Bacon & Peaches Taco

By the way the most expensive taco we had was $2.50. The selection alone is reason enough to try this place multiple times. My favorite taco was the California because anytime you add fries to anything, it always gets better. I've had a California burrito before with fries but never a California taco and to that I say... well done. Both Mateo and I give Taco Cow 4 out of 5 tacos for their Taco Tuesday Review.
